Webb1 feb. 2011 · Coherence bandwidth f0 is a statistical measure of the range of frequencies over which all the signal spectral components are affected in a similar way by the channel i.e. exhibiting fading or no fading. Slow fading occurs when the coherence time of the channel is larger relative to the delay constraint of the channel. The amplitude and phase change imposed by the channel can be considered roughly constant over the period of use.
